    Optimizing Social Interaction through Digital Tools: Methodological Approaches and Practical Applications of Information Systems
    (2026) Visyn, Valentyn; Martyniuk, Yaroslava; Maiboroda, Oksana; Haponchuk, Olena; Silvestrova, Oksana; Sushyk, Iryna
    Today's digital technologies have changed the way people interact with each other, leading to big advances in mobile technology and trustworthy online databases. Bibliographic synthesis, statistical analysis, and structured organization and interpretation of the data that was collected were some of the methods used in the study. A database of social media platforms and official online resources was processed. The analysis was supplemented by research on the integration of modern psychosocial strategies into the formation of public discourse and initiatives to increase transparency. Special emphasis was placed on assessing the adaptive processes necessary for the use of information and communication tеchnologies in socio-economically disadvantaged regions. The results of the study showed that the prevailing methodological approaches are characterized by targeted communication strategies, effectively charged rhetoric, the influence of social validation, dynamic content presentation, and heterogeneous effectiveness of digital platform deployment. Combined with psychosocial and sociocultural principles, these approaches contribute to the emergence of adaptive social structures that develop in analytically sound ways. At the same time, excessive emphasis on cognitive and behavioral factors emphasizes the limitations of exclusively textual articulation of strategy - a phenomenon within the concept of "spelling postmodernism", which reflects potential vulnerabilities for the integrity of cybernetic systems. Research on contemporary communication processes has revealed a deficit of autonomy of operational mechanisms, which are contrasted with the background of developing institutional paradigms. We believe that these should be constantly improved and adapted to keep communication tactics and government programs more effective.

    Communication Strategies in the Social Sphere: Tactics and Information and Communication Technologies
    (2025) Visyn, Valentyn; Martyniuk, Yaroslava; Maiboroda, Oksana; Haponchuk, Olena; Silvestrova, Oksana; Sushyk, Iryna
    Introduction: Digital technologies are transforming communication and social interaction, and information and communication technologies are becoming vital tools for solving social problems and improving access to information. They promote effective interaction between the state and citizens, improving the quality of social services and governance. Objectives: The study aims to analyse and develop effective communication strategies and tactics to improve social interaction. It also aims to study the role of information and communication technologies (ICT) in access to social services, engaging citizens in initiatives, and optimising information exchange between government agencies and the public. Methods: The study uses analytical and systematic methods and statistical analysis to assess the effectiveness of strategies. The analysis of social media and official websites revealed the main communication topics and areas of application of social and psychological technologies in forming communication strategies in the social sphere. Results: It was found that developing new communication models is essential for improving information exchange, engaging citizens in social initiatives, and adapting policies based on feedback. Social media and participatory approaches allow for more effective audience engagement, while artificial intelligence and data analysis help manage communications. Media literacy training stimulates critical thinking, and ICTs significantly impact social group interaction, especially in low-income countries. Conclusions: The study confirmed that effective communication strategies are vital in improving interaction between social groups and organisations. The use of ICTs and participatory methods contributes to transparency, accessibility, and engagement of citizens in social initiatives. Strategic planning, adaptation of messages for different audiences, personal stories and data increase the credibility of initiatives.
